Gómez is a small area in Panama, located in the Bugaba District of the Chiriquí Province. In Panama, places like Gómez are called a corregimiento. Think of a corregimiento as a local administrative area, a bit like a small town or a specific part of a larger district.

About Gómez

Gómez is part of the beautiful Chiriquí Province, which is known for its green landscapes and mountains. It's located in the western part of Panama, close to the border with Costa Rica.

Land Area and Size

The land area of Gómez is about 40.8 square kilometers. To help you imagine this, it's roughly the size of 4,080 soccer fields! This measurement helps us understand how much space the area covers.

Population and People

In 2010, about 2,702 people lived in Gómez. This number helps us know how many residents call Gómez home. The population has changed a bit over the years:

  • In 1990, there were 2,468 people.
  • In 2000, the population was 2,422.
  • By 2010, it had grown to 2,702.

Population Density

When we talk about population density, we mean how many people live in each square kilometer. For Gómez, the population density was about 66.2 people per square kilometer in 2010. This tells us that Gómez is not a very crowded place, with a moderate number of people spread out across its land area.
